Job Description

Job Overview:
Working under the direction of the Logistics Manager, the Logistics Administrator will be responsible for processing customer orders and all related customer routing documents and instructions, from the Leominster Traffic Coordinators, in a timely manner.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

All documents must be reviewed for correctness, and Leominster Traffic Coordinators are to be contacted immediately, with any perceived customer issues/compliances. Create all customer documents based upon their requirements, i.e. Pick Tickets, Shipping Labels, Master BOL s, Custom Documents, Quick Base entries, etc. Create daily shipping schedules and coordinate with Shipping/Warehouse Managers on the daily shipping schedule. Also, to work closely with customer specific trucking companies by assigning pickup appointments that comply with customer standards. Communicate and interact with Shipping/Warehouse Managers, Customer Service and Distribution Managers, to ensure smooth flow of shipments, which satisfies all Customer Compliance demands, avoiding the potential for penalties or fines Immediately report any issues with product or equipment, any unsafe conditions or actions of other employees, to the Traffic Manger Other Duties as assigned by the Traffic Manager.
Qualifications:
High School diploma or equivalent Minimum of one year of related experience in retail, wholesale warehousing or logistics Minimum of one year experience working in a warehouse management system, IQMS preferred. Excellent computer skills (MS office applications). Strong team player who remains positive and flexible amidst changing priorities Physically able to lift between 1-35 lbs., sit climb, stoop, kneel, and crouch. Able to travel and have means of transportation. Superior organizational and communication skills Ability to read and speak English fluently; Spanish/English bilingual a plus Forklift experience a plus General understanding of supply chain, production, distribution concepts.
